What is Site Investigation & Characterization

From a Flagged Concern to Measured Facts

A Phase I ESA flags the possibility of contamination. Site investigation and characterization is where that possibility becomes measured fact: where it is, what it is, how much, and how far. A-Tech collects and analyzes physical samples of soil, water, vapor, and waste, then compares the results against the regulatory screening levels that apply to your site, so you and your agency work from the same defensible data set.

Delineation

We map the vertical and lateral extent of contamination: the source, the plume boundaries, and which media are affected. Knowing the true footprint keeps a cleanup scoped to reality instead of guesswork.

Characterization

We identify the specific contaminants and their concentrations, profile waste streams for disposal, and compare findings to DTSC, Regional Water Board, and federal thresholds. You get a report agencies accept and a path to closure you can budget for.

When you Need Site Investigation & Characterization

Characterization is rarely optional once a concern surfaces. The sooner it is done right, the more control you keep over cost and timeline.

  • A Phase I Identified a Concern. A Recognized Environmental Concern (REC) needs to be confirmed or cleared with actual sampling before a transaction can close.
  • A Regulator Is Asking Questions. DTSC, a Regional Water Quality Control Board, or a local agency has requested characterization of a known or suspected release.
  • You’re Closing or Removing a UST. Tank closures require soil and groundwater sampling to show whether a release occurred and to define its extent.
  • You’re Redeveloping or Building. Excavation, dewatering, and soil export all depend on knowing what is in the ground and how it must be handled or disposed of.
  • You Need to Profile Waste. Soil and materials leaving the site must be characterized and profiled so they go to a properly permitted facility.
  • You’re Managing Ongoing Compliance. Boundary monitoring, discharge sampling, and landfill gas evaluations keep active sites inside their permit conditions.

Investigation Costs Less Than Getting The Cleanup Wrong

Characterizing a site costs a fraction of remediating one. It costs less still than cleaning up the wrong volume, missing a plume, or having an agency reject your data and send you back to the field. The figures below show what is at stake.

Figure What It Represents
583,000+ Confirmed releases from underground storage tanks nationwide, the most common trigger for site investigation. (U.S. EPA, March 2026)
~54,000 UST release sites still awaiting cleanup completion nationwide, active liabilities that depend on accurate characterization. (U.S. EPA)
~$154,000 Average cost to clean up a single leaking UST site. That number climbs with how far contamination spreads before it is defined. (U.S. EPA)
From ~$10,000 Low-end cost of a soil-only cleanup caught early, versus $100,000 to more than $1 million once contamination reaches groundwater. (U.S. EPA)
$23,000 to $25,000 Typical cost of a focused Phase II site investigation for a modest site, the step that keeps remediation scoped to reality. (Phase II ESA cost analysis, inflation-adjusted)
~$1 billion Spent every year by state cleanup funds on UST-related remediation, a market that rewards defensible, closure-oriented data. (U.S. EPA)

Figures are national reference estimates from U.S. EPA Underground Storage Tank program data and California UST Cleanup Fund cost guidance. Actual costs vary with contaminant type, media affected, site conditions, and applicable state cleanup standards.

Frequently Asked Questions

A Phase II ESA is the first round of sampling that confirms whether a suspected contaminant is actually present. Site characterization goes further. Once contamination is confirmed, it defines the full vertical and lateral extent, identifies every affected medium, and profiles the contaminants so a cleanup can be properly scoped. The two often flow together, and A-Tech handles both.

It depends on site size, the media involved, and how many sampling locations are needed, but a focused investigation for a modest site typically runs in the low tens of thousands of dollars. That is a small fraction of the average leaking-UST cleanup, roughly $154,000 nationally, which is why accurate characterization up front protects your budget. We provide a scoped estimate after a short consultation.

Field work for a straightforward site is often finished in a few days, with laboratory turnaround and reporting typically adding two to four weeks. Timelines run longer for larger sites, groundwater investigations, or where agency coordination and permitting are required. We give you a realistic schedule as part of the work plan.
